Frequently Asked Questions

How do University of South Carolina-Salkehatchie and New Mexico Military Institute compare?
University of South Carolina-Salkehatchie (Allendale, SC) has an acceptance rate of 76.0%, in-state tuition of $7,558, and median 10-year earnings of $31,360. New Mexico Military Institute (Roswell, NM) has an acceptance rate of 52.6%, in-state tuition of $7,190, and median 10-year earnings of $57,410.
Which school has higher graduate earnings, University of South Carolina-Salkehatchie or New Mexico Military Institute?
New Mexico Military Institute graduates earn more at 10 years out, with a median of $57,410 vs $31,360. Source: U.S. Department of Education College Scorecard.
Which school is more affordable, University of South Carolina-Salkehatchie or New Mexico Military Institute?
Based on average net price (after grants and scholarships), New Mexico Military Institute is the more affordable option at $4,571 per year versus $9,229.
